Raeda Al Sarayreh, Director of Communications Nissan Africa, Middle East & India Region

UAE

Raeda joined Nissan in Oct 2019 as Director of Corporate Communications overseeing communications operations across Africa, Middle East and India. She started her career as a diplomat at the Embassy of Jordan in Washington DC – USA back in 1997 and moved to Jordan to work as the Head of Press and Policy Coordinator at the office of HM Queen Rania Al Abdullah of Jordan. Raeda is an experienced corporate affairs professional, with strong background in reputation recovery and issues management. She also held P&L responsibilities within her role as UAE Country Director managing a 50 million USD portfolio for US based firm CH2M in 2017/18.
Her career included several stints within public policy, government relations, communications and marketing through appointments with multinationals, sovereign wealth funds, technology investment and government organizations.
Raeda is a strong advocate for advancing women in the workforce through measurable and practical strategies that target attraction, promotion, developing and retention of women. She is the Chair of the steering committee of the 30% Club MENA, a global multi-sector volunteer effort aimed at increasing women representation in C-Suite positions and on boards.
Raeda holds an M.Sc. in Engineering Management from the Catholic University of America, and a B.Sc. in Chemical Engineering from the University of Jordan and has completed a one-year executive leadership program with the Haas School of Business, University of California- Berkeley. She is also a certified Executive Coach.
Raeda was awarded The Independence Medal by His Majesty King Abdullah II of Jordan in 2002 for outstanding service to the country in recognition for her work on the extraordinary Arab League Summit in Amman 2003.
